Abstract
Cancer/testis (CT) antigen is a group of antigens that are expressed in a wide variety of malignant tumors but not in normal adult tissues except for testis. Since CT antigens are immunogenic and highly restricted to tumors, they are considered as ideal targets for cancer immunotherapy. Many clinical studies targeting CT antigens have been tested. Here we review the history and the recent progress of clinical studies targeting MAGE family and NY-ESO-1 including our trials.
